Last month, students in Weather Analysis and Instrumentation launched a weather balloon, tracked the Vaisala radiosonde data, and forecasted when the balloon would burst. #sounding #weatherballoon

Before Fall Break, students in Weather Analysis and Instrumentation took a field trip to the USGS Sleepers River Research Watershed to learn about hydrologic instruments, including snow tubes. They also got to see some beautiful fall foliage in the Northeast Kingdom!💧❄️🌲🍁
